have amortization table, that you input starting date at the top of the form
and it fills in the monthly due dates, based upon the term in years, and includes interest and principal etc. i have a helper cell that takes the date as =YEAR(A1)then a copy and paste so the cell contains actual number rather than formula. i want to color all the even years in green and the odd in gold, using this cond format =$XX/2=int($XX/2) and same except < replaces =. (The cond formatting would apply to the columns 1 thru 19. using MS Ofc 07 thx |
